Superior Chemical Resistance and Longevity
The exceptional chemical resistance of irrigation hdpe pipe stems from its molecular structure, which remains unaffected by agricultural chemicals, fertilizers, herbicides, pesticides, and naturally occurring soil compounds. This remarkable property ensures system integrity throughout decades of exposure to harsh agricultural environments where other pipe materials would deteriorate rapidly. Traditional metal pipes suffer from electrochemical corrosion when exposed to fertilizers containing chlorides, sulfates, and nitrates, leading to premature failure and costly replacements. The irrigation hdpe pipe maintains its structural integrity and flow characteristics regardless of chemical exposure levels, providing consistent performance season after season. pH variations in irrigation water, ranging from acidic to alkaline conditions, have no impact on pipe material properties, unlike concrete pipes that can deteriorate under acidic conditions. The non-reactive surface prevents scale formation and mineral buildup that commonly plague metal distribution systems, maintaining optimal flow rates throughout the system lifespan. Agricultural operations benefit tremendously from this chemical stability, as irrigation hdpe pipe can safely transport treated wastewater, recycled water, and chemically enhanced irrigation solutions without material degradation concerns. The longevity advantage translates directly into economic benefits, with properly installed irrigation hdpe pipe systems providing reliable service for 50-100 years under normal agricultural conditions. This extended service life eliminates multiple replacement cycles required with alternative materials, significantly reducing total cost of ownership. Environmental temperature variations, freeze-thaw cycles, and UV exposure contribute additional stress factors that irrigation hdpe pipe handles exceptionally well due to its polymer structure and stabilization additives. Field testing demonstrates that irrigation hdpe pipe maintains pressure ratings and flow characteristics even after decades of service, while comparable metal systems show measurable performance degradation within 15-20 years. The chemical inertness also ensures that irrigation hdpe pipe will not leach harmful substances into the water supply, making it ideal for organic farming operations and potable water applications.
